Welcome to Canis Major

a wolf and animal rpg (role-playing game)

Canis is a writing community for play-by-post (forum-based), freeform roleplay set in a fictional dream world in the intrusion fantasy genre. Most characters on Canis are wolves; many play elements are focused around wolves and canids, but the world makes room for a large variety of other animal characters such as dogs, horses, cats, bears, deer, and many, many more.

Our community is focused on flexibility, creativity, and collaboration. That boils down to a few important features:

  • There is no set activity requirement to write
  • The setting and plot are member-created and staff-supported
  • The game is continuously improved to increase fun and decrease stress

Learn more in our Rulebook!

x February 23: Shiroshika has disbanded


Content Warning
01-02-2025, 07:57 PM (This post was last modified: 01-02-2025, 08:14 PM by Rashepses. Edited 1 time in total.)
This content is not visible to non-members.

the staff team luvs u
01-02-2025, 08:25 PM
 the Gods were with them. They had brought them here, whole and hale and some looked as though years had left them! it felt her prayers were answered, and all curses upon them had been lifted. other than her people, Toula had dug free from the earth the gift her father had first given her that offered her protection.
 with this new life came old desires, too. every time she looked to her husband her heart leapt into her throat! they had been good leaders, and good parents both this day—all rested now, settling after the chaos and commotion. she kissed her children atop their crowns and rest alongside her husband.
 except she could not sleep! just as she was about the wake him, she opened her eyes to meet the gilt of his own. she suppressed a laugh only for as long as they were within hearing distance of the rest,
 and then she could no longer withhold the girlish giggle that bubbled forth! joy, insurmountable joy—well, no, because it grew all the more as she felt him begin to administer his affections upon her! pushed into the sands, Toula gasped softly—and when he stood poised between her legs like that, when he looked at her that way… “Rashepses,” she whispered, her eyes darkened with desire! consume me!

the staff team luvs u
Content Warning
01-02-2025, 08:59 PM (This post was last modified: 01-02-2025, 09:00 PM by Rashepses. Edited 1 time in total.)
This content is not visible to non-members.

the staff team luvs u
01-02-2025, 09:46 PM (This post was last modified: 01-17-2025, 04:00 PM by Toula. Edited 1 time in total.)
 with each touch, she felt as though she ascended. it was always this way—she did not think it was possible for it to end. no, now she knew it would not. before he spoke his questions she marveled to him, with him, “lifetimes, my love!” and if this was not proof of Their divinity, Their promise, she did not know what else ever could be! and together, They had the power to protect their people, to bring them to this place!
 had she considered it? “I have thought much of it,” she wanted it, truth be told. “but I must think a little longer still,” for she had never seen it before! “have you seen it done, Raemka?” she wondered to him, curbing her desire long enough to speak with him on what she knew mattered in his heart!
 but she could not resist one more kiss where her lips lingered, her eyes sparkling all the while.

the staff team luvs u
Content Warning
01-04-2025, 03:50 PM
This content is not visible to non-members.

the staff team luvs u
01-07-2025, 12:08 PM
 her eyes twinkled at his words. how much they both had not seen—and then seen together! he had elevated her, she too would elevate him. playful, she said, “the women-Pharaohs in my family are known to be fierce,” but was that not the truth? her aunt had a reputation that many knew, even if they had not seen her for themselves. Makono… her reign had not lasted long, but she had made a name for herself and it was not at all delicate in its nature!
 but among them, Toula had been the one to rule two lands. to bring more peace to her people, to grant new freedoms. she leaned into her husband. “tell me, what would you do as Pharaoh, should I grant this?” what were his dreams? there seemed to be no question of if here—not then! a soft kiss to his lips, encouraging.

the staff team luvs u
Content Warning
01-07-2025, 10:09 PM (This post was last modified: 01-07-2025, 10:10 PM by Rashepses.)
This content is not visible to non-members.

the staff team luvs u
Content Warning
01-12-2025, 06:04 PM
This content is not visible to non-members.

the staff team luvs u
Content Warning
01-12-2025, 11:03 PM
This content is not visible to non-members.

the staff team luvs u
Content Warning
01-17-2025, 02:54 PM
This content is not visible to non-members.

the staff team luvs u
01-17-2025, 03:27 PM
 He thought of Ta-senet. He thought of the serpent that flowed through Akashingo and held all in her thrall. He and Toula had spent days of delight bathing together within the waters and idling upon her banks. Playing with the children. Making love in the shade. The river lay heavily upon the flatlands, bright as spilling ichor. It fed their olives and sycamore figs, moistened the earth for lotus and mandrake and attracted all manner of prey to her shores. Hapi had let fly His wrath in the inundation. He would be appeased again.

 And so there was only one answer the king found appropriate:

 “A river, my love,” and he shuffled through Toula’s cheeks with an adoring nose.

the staff team luvs u
01-17-2025, 04:17 PM
 a river! she nods, leaning into his ministrations with a happy hum—“yes, a river—where we shall hold ceremonies, in the season of its flooding. hmm, I should also like for there to be foliage as we had in Muat-Riya—lush and dense and lovely! and oh, a place with many rooms—though ours shall be…” she mused on, smiling—laughing through the hours with her husband, hearing his wishes too.
 peace, peace at last—and joy she could scarcely keep within her. soon enough, her husband again became the direct recipient of it, until she slept—dreaming of their future. of a grander Akashingo!

the staff team luvs u
scroll to top